In this episode, Juan Carlos Machorro and Francisco Udave, partners at our firm, analyze a recent ruling by the Supreme Court of Justice of the Nation that redefines the approach to justified dismissal in Mexico. Based on a case handled by our firm, the Court validated that employers can prove the justification for dismissal with contrary evidence, even without having issued any termination notice.
The context and scope of this ruling are discussed, as well as its possible implications within the current labor justice system.
